The Role of a Veterinary Technician in Lindsay MT <\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"catAmong the first decisions that you will need to make is if you desire to train as a vet technician, assistant or technologist. Part of your determination might be based on the amount of time and money that you have to invest in your education, but the main determiner will probably be which specialty appeals to you the most. What techs and assistants have in common is that they both work under the immediate supervision of a licensed and practicing veterinarian. And while there are many jobs that they can perform within the Lindsay MT veterinary practice or hospital, they can’t prescribe medicines, diagnose ailments, or perform surgical procedures. In those areas they may only furnish assistance to a licensed veterinarian. There are technicians and technologists that work exclusive of the conventional vet practice, for example for zoos, animal shelters or law enforcement.
